Kalimpong Fans Satisfied With Bagan's 5-0 Display
Mohun Bagan’s pre-season got off to a flier as they trounced Kalimpong XI 5-0 at the Kalimpong Stadium this afternoon amidst all the hustle and bustle of the fans....
Though Kalimpong football lovers rooted for their team, they were equally pleased with Bagan’s football and the atmosphere was contagious.
The match was divided into three halves of 30 minutes each so that both teams could use all their players. In Kalimpong XI’s case, it was about the chance to play against a big club and hence, each and every player wanted to have that honour.
Mohun Bagan general secretary, Anjan Mitra, was present at the stadium to witness the match. He was pleased with the outcome as well as with the support.
Despite the foggy conditions and the drizzle, people came out in numbers, which was worth appreciating. What they saw left them satiated, although they were still yearning for more.
All in all, it was a great match for the people of Kalimpong, who have a notable footballing tradition.
